## Deploying the Gatewick Proctor Queue

Deploys are pretty painless: push to main, wait for the pipeline, then watch the queue drain dashboard for five minutes. If candidates pile up mid-exam, roll back first and ask questions later — the queue replays safely. Everything the workers care about lives in one config block, shown here for reference.

settings of bafof-yagef:
JOROX_PIN=8740
JOROX_TENANT=pelox
JOROX_METRICS_HOST=metrics.jorox.qorvelworks.internal
JOROX_SEAL=seal_c78f63c1
JOROX_STANDBY_TEAM=norax

# Tollgate Consent Banner — Environments

The Tollgate consent banner rolls out across three environments: sandbox, preview, and production. Sandbox disables consent persistence entirely; preview stores choices in Varnholt-region storage only; production enforces regional residency. Reviewers should confirm that logging excludes pre-consent identifiers. Each environment's enforced configuration appears below.

config for hawep-taweg:
[frair]
port = 8443
region = west-3
host = frair.sivrelhq.internal
team = oliael
timeout_ms = 1000
retries = 2

MINUTES — Management Meeting, Corvane Retail Group

Present: all heads of department. Chair: P. Ashworth.

1. Loyalty overhaul approved in principle. Current Starpoints scheme retired end of Q3.
2. Replacement tiered model ("Corvane Circle") pilots at Bramfield stores first.
3. IT to scope migration; Marketing to draft member comms.
4. Budget reallocation deferred to next session.

Actions logged with each head. Strategic detail for restricted circulation appears below.

management briefing: The renewal with Quenathox Group closes at $10 million a year, 20 percent below the last contract. Project Ulawyn slips by two quarters because of the supplier delay.